WHOOP is an advanced health and fitness wearable, on a mission to unlock human performance. WHOOP empowers its members to improve their health and perform at a higher level by providing a deep understanding of their bodies and daily lives.
As a Data Scientist on our Women’s Health team, you will develop algorithmic features and metrics that impact Women’s health initiatives. By leveraging various data sources to combine WHOOP data with “gold standard” truth data, as well as drawing upon clinical theory and evidence, you will work with a team of data scientists to design, train, deploy, and maintain machine learning algorithms to provide insights to members on a wide range of topics. As part of our production data science team, you’ll work with MLOps engineers to create and maintain robust services that host data science algorithms. 

RESPONSABILITES:

  • Develop statistical and machine learning models to solve complex problems with data of varying structures
  • Conduct research on specific health and physiological problems and integrate clinical research into the development of algorithms 
  • Productionize models and algorithms, monitor production service in the field 
  • Work with software engineers and MLOps engineers to stand up production backend applications in Python that pass data through inference pipelines.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Statistics, Data Science, Applied Mathematics, Artificial Intelligence, Computer Science, or a related field
  • 1+ years of full-time professional experience in a related area
  • 2+ years experience applying advanced machine learning and statistical techniques
  • Strong python programming skills and substantial experience with scientific python packages
  • A strong interest in improving health and well-being through wearable technology
  • Preferred Qualification: Experience working with processed physiological time series data such as that from PPG, ECG, or EEG sensors
  • Preferred Qualification: Experience deploying services and maintaining live code through logging and monitoring within a production environment
  • Preferred Qualification: Knowledge of women’s health and physiology, including reproductive health, menstrual cycles, and related biometrics
  • Preferred Qualification: Knowledge of software development processes and the software lifecycle.
